Laravel Информация о группах пользователей Google API - PullRequest
0 голосов
/ 27 мая 2020

На работе у нас есть Google G Suite, мне удалось создать веб-сайт с помощью Laravel, где каждый коллега должен войти в свою учетную запись Gmail. После входа в систему пользователь аутентифицируется и может просматривать всю информацию. Эта часть работает правильно.

Кроме того, мы пытаемся создать несколько страниц, доступных только для определенных c групп Google. Эти группы находятся здесь https://groups.google.com/. Я проверял и пытался получить список групп от зарегистрированного пользователя, но не могу запустить его.

Я пытался использовать это: https://developers.google.com/admin-sdk/directory/v1/reference/groups/list Но я только получил такие сообщения: This error may be due to using an insufficient credential type. Try using OAuth 2.0.

Я подхожу к сути, например: Моя учетная запись - это просто пользователь в G Suite, поэтому можно ли получить группы авторизованного пользователя без необходимости администратор или владелец этих групп или G Suite?

...